/*
Version 16.0 reformatted to use u8g2 fonts
1. Added ß to translations, eventually that conversion can move to the lang_xx.h file
2. Spaced temperature, pressure and precipitation equally, suggest in DE use 'niederschlag' for 'Rain/Snow'
3. No-longer displays Rain or Snow unless there has been any.
4. The nn-mm 'Rain suffix' has been replaced with two rain drops
5. Similarly for 'Snow' two snow flakes, no words and '=Rain' and '"=Snow' for none have gone.
6. Improved the Cloud Cover icon and only shows if reported, 0% cloud (clear sky) is no-report and no icon.
7. Added a Visibility icon and reported distance in Metres. Only shows if reported.
8. Fixed the occasional sleep time error resulting in constant restarts, occurred when updates took longer than expected.
9. Improved the smaller sun icon.
10. Added more space for the Sunrise/Sunset and moon phases when translated.
Version 16.1 Correct timing errors after sleep - persistent problem that is not deterministic
1. Removed Weather (Main) category e.g. previously 'Clear (Clear sky)', now only shows area category of 'Clear sky' and then ', caterory1' and ', category2'
2. Improved accented character displays
Version 16.2 Correct comestic icon issues
1. At night the addition of a moon icon overwrote the Visibility report, so order of drawing was changed to prevent this.
2. RainDrop icon was too close to the reported value of icon_64x64_10d moved right. Same for Snow Icon.
3. Improved large sun icon sun rays and improved all icon drawing logic, rain drops now use common shape.
5. Moved MostlyCloudy Icon down to align with the rest, same for MostlySunny.
6. Improved graph axis alignment.
Version 16.3 Correct comestic icon issues
1. Reverted some aspects of UpdateLocalTime() as locialisation changes were unecessary and can be achieved through lang_aa.h files
2. Correct configuration mistakes with moon calculations.
Version 16.4 Corrected time server addresses and adjusted maximum time-out delay
1. Moved time-server address to the credentials file
2. Increased wait time for a valid time setup to 10-secs
3. Added a lowercase conversion of hemisphere to allow for 'North' or 'NORTH' or 'nOrth' entries for hemisphere
4. Adjusted graph y-axis alignment, redcued number of x dashes
Version 16.5 Clarified connections for Waveshare ESP32 driver board
1. Added SPI.end(); and SPI.begin(CLK, MISO, MOSI, CS); to enable explicit definition of pins to be used.
Version 16.6 changed GxEPD2 initialisation from 115200 to 0
1. Display.init(115200); becomes ecran._display->init(0); to stop blank screen following update to GxEPD2
Version 16.7 changed u8g2 fonts selection
1. Omitted 'FONT(' and added _tf to font names either Regular (R) or Bold (B)
Version 16.8
1. Added extra 20-secs of sleep to allow for slow ESP32 RTC timers
Version 16.9
1. Added probability of precipitation display e.g. 17%
Version 16.10
1. Updated display inittialisation for 7.5" T7 display type, which iss now the standard 7.5" display type.
Version 16.11
1. Adjusted graph drawing for negative numbers
2. Correct offset error for precipitation
Version 16.12
1. Modified to enable 1/2 buffer display of 3-colour displays
